Question
From a point 50 meters away from the base of a tower,
the angle of elevation of the top of the tower is 30°. Find the height of the tower.Solution
Let the height of the tower be h meters. Using the tan function, tan 30° = height/base = h/50 √3/3 = h/50 h = (50 * √3) / 3 = 50√3 / 3 meters.
